I believe that designers have a significant role in society, and that is not only to create aesthetically beautiful and informative work but to also bring awareness to critical issues that capture people's attention. Moreover, I hope that I can inspire young generations of artists and Latinx individuals to pursue their dreams of making art as a living. My art style is characterized by its bright and vibrant colors, which I use to express my creativity. I enjoy researching new topics that interest me and integrating them into my work, I like to push boundaries on what design could mean and try to create impactful design that resonates with viewers even after they've seen it. I am inspired by my community of first-generation students and my Mexican heritage to create work that can make a change and give art a new perspective so that it can be acknowledged as a powerful tool and a successful career.
